The role

This is a great opportunity for a Project Manager or a Contracts Administrator, currently working in the building or consulting sectors, who would like to develop their skills as a Project Manager in a true client-side role. 

You will be responsible for:

  • Design management including preparing consultant briefs, coordinating consultants and resolving any design issues.
  • Preparing, monitoring and reporting on project programmes.
  • Procurement of consultants and contractors including developing tender documents, assessment of responses and awarding of contracts.
  • Cost management, reviewing budgets, claims, variations and processing of payments.
  • Identifying, documenting and monitoring project risks, effectively managing them through the project lifecycle to reduce exposure to the business.

Engaging with stakeholders including councils, state government bodies, project consultants, and contractors, you’ll build strong relationships, develop solutions to complex problems and promote a collaborative environment that drives programmes and gets the best outcomes for the project.
